
Holiday Sketching- Vietnam 8-21 November, 2008. Tutor Leonie Norton Vietnam is a peaceful place, a picturesque place, a friendly place -the perfect patch of paradise to relax and develop new skills. Time to wander, time to sit and sketch in the company of a skilled tutor -Leonie Norton and a group of like minded souls is what the Safari ‘Drawing Vietnam’ has to offer. All the details are taken care of so you have the chance to be immersed in a rich culture, beautiful landscape, good food and welcoming villages. We will start in atmospheric Old Hanoi and then travel into the countryside, stay in comfortable hotels as well as take the opportunity to get off the tourist trails to stay in a village in a traditional family home [they do have western bathroom facilities for us]. As the mood suits us and the scenery inspires us we have the chance to stop, wander and sketch. Scenery will range from the Old Town of Hanoi to rice paddies, bustling little village markets, riverscapes, lush tropical rainforest to the magical rock formations of Halong Bay. After breakfast each day we will spend time focusing on a particular element- clouds, water, morning light, people and etc before we head out for the day, evenings there will be a chance to look at and discuss work, add those final touches. All skill levels are welcome, from those who have never attempted sketching, to those who already visually record their experiences.
